The question

Does one's conscience become clear by asking a mufti and a scholar about the non-occurrence of divorce? And is it permissible to adopt the view of those who say that divorce did not occur if more than one mufti has given such a fatwa, while only one shaykh has given a fatwa that it did occur?

The answer

The divorce of a person afflicted by obsessive-compulsive disorder (waswasah) does not take effect if it occurred under the influence of this waswasah. Such a person is permitted to adopt the easier opinion to avoid hardship. As long as he is afflicted by waswasah, he cannot be certain that he uttered the divorce in a state free from waswasah. Thus, the default remains that his divorce has not occurred. He should not frequently ask or delve into matters of divorce as long as he is afflicted by waswasah, because that strengthens the obsessions.
